Natural Remedies to Help Treat MS

Multiple Sclerosis (MS) is an autoimmune disease which results in degenerative nerve damage. This inflammatory disease affects Caucasian women more than any other group, and it affects less than 1 million people throughout the United States. Smoking, meat-heavy diets, and ingesting preservatives can lead to the progression of MS. Many baby boomers and retirees may be faced with the struggles and discomfort from Multiple Sclerosis. If you or an aging loved one in a  facility or homecare suffers from MS, it is good to know the natural remedies that are available to help with the pain and suffering.

Fighting the Effects of Aging with Vitamin D

Vitamin D, also known as the sunshine vitamin, may help seniors fight the effects of aging. Seniors may not have a chance to go into the sunshine if they are in an assisted living facility, therefore it is very important to make sure that your senior loved one in a senior care facility gets to go into the direct sunlight for 10-15 minutes each sunny day. The body needs Vitamin D to process other vitamins and nutrients in the body, so it is very important to get  your sunshine Vitamin D.

Thickened Drinks and Meals for Seniors

Senior DrinkingSome seniors can drink ice water with no issues, however many seniors need thickened drinks as they age. Many nursing homes can provide these thickened products to seniors. The meals and drinks can be thickened to help the body thrive. Many companies provide an at-home thickening mixture that seniors can use while living at-home or receiving homecare services.
